  • ECJ: EU Rules Prohibit Certification of Certain Halal Meat

    March 05, 2019

    The Court of Justice of the EU (ECJ) recently held that EU law prohibits the use of an “Organic” EU production logo for meat from animals slaughtered under Islamic halal rules that were not stunned prior to their killing.

  • Pakistan Bans Islamist Charities Linked to Terrorism

    March 05, 2019

    Pakistan's National Security Committee added two Islamist charities linked to extremist ideology and terrorist violence to a list of banned organizations in the face of mounting international pressure for Islamabad to curb its support for Islamist radical activities in South Asia and beyond.
